Victorian Three Stone Diamond Engagement Ring, c.1900s

This delicate and elegant ring is a classic three stone design, symbolising the past, present and future of the relationship. The stunnign diamonds are all old cuts and have a combined weight of 0.70 carat. The centre stone is slightly bigger, weighing 0.30 carat, and is highlighted by the horizontally set 0.20 carat diamonds either side. The stones are estimated as G in colour and VS2 in clarity, high quality goods. The ring dates back to the 1900s and is typically Victorian in style. The diamonds are rub over set within platinum, finished with delicate mille-grain edging, whilst the gallery and shank are crafted from 18 carat yellow gold. The beautiful hoops detailing is all hand created, and the platinum flows into the shoulders allowing the stones to shine.
